Did you know our employees in the UK have two Volunteer Days a year to spend on charities close to their hearts? Here we catch up with Agnes, who recently pitched in to make a difference at local charity, Young Bristol.

What do you do in AtkinsRéalis?

I'm a Structural Engineer. Working at AtkinsRéalis allows me to help different clients solve problems in their engineering endeavours. I have the opportunity to design places and spaces that make a positive impact on people and the environment. For example, I'm developing new engineering solutions that will contribute towards decarbonization on one of my current projects.

What are Volunteer Days?

AtkinsRéalis has a strong #GivingBack Culture. On top of our annual leave, we can use our volunteer days to participate in fundraising activities, community works – the choice is ours. One of the organization's big focuses is getting young people excited about STEM Careers. This often throws up opportunities to get involved with young people in local charities.

Why Young Bristol?

Young Bristol opens so many doors to young people in crisis. Many of these teenagers may have been exploited, abused or neglected. They can also experience mental health challenges and poverty or inequality because of their ethnicity, sexuality, disability or gender identity.

Young Bristol tackles this by helping every young person discover what they're capable of. It provides a safe place for them to meet and get involved in fun activities with other members of the community.

What did you do on your Volunteer Day?

The whole AtkinsRéalis team was highly energized. We had an incredible time getting to know the Young Bristol team and seeing the positive results at the end of the volunteering day.

After doing some gardening and painting, we got stuck into converting an exterior area. We used our engineering skills to make the most of the centre's outdoor space, providing more seating and activity areas. The centre can now welcome and support more people.

Many people in Bristol benefit from Young Bristol's great work, so giving back to them was incredible!

How did the experience make a difference to you?

We were all personally moved on the day, meeting the people behind Young Bristol and seeing what they do day-to-day. It made us want to get even more involved with this organization. Professionally it allowed us to put our minds together for a great cause. It helped us improve our communication skills as a group and get to know each other better.
